One crucial aspect of thesis writing is crafting a literature review that not only demonstrates your understanding of the existing research but also establishes the foundation for your own study.

Writing a literature review requires extensive research, critical analysis, and effective synthesis of information from various sources. It involves identifying key themes, debates, and gaps in the existing literature while also evaluating the credibility and relevance of each source. Additionally, synthesizing diverse perspectives into a cohesive narrative demands meticulous attention to detail and strong analytical skills.

Navigating through the vast sea of scholarly articles, books, and other resources can be daunting, especially for those new to academic research. Moreover, distinguishing between relevant and irrelevant sources, and integrating them seamlessly into your review, adds another layer of complexity to the process.
